Franklin Emerging Market Core Dividend Tilt Index ETF (DIEM) and iShares MSCI Emerging Markets ETF (EEM) belong to the same industry segment: EM Large & Mid Cap. DIEM's top 3 sector exposures are Technology, Finance and Energy. In contrast, EEM's top sector exposures are Technology, Finance and Non-Energy Materials. DIEM is less exp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.19%, versus 0.72% for EEM. DIEM is up 22.34% year-to-date (YTD) with +$31M in YTD flows. EEM performs worse with 16.47% YTD performance, and +$3.49B in YTD flows. Run a side-by-side ETF comparison of DIEM and EEM below, and assess how they stack up in performance, liquidity, risk, exposure, holdings, and more, helping you select the best ETF for your investments.

Frequently asked questions about DIEM and EEM

How have the DIEM and EEM ETFs performed in 2026?

As of July 17, 2026, DIEM is up 22.34% year-to-date (YTD), while EEM has returned 16.47%. That puts DIEM better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: DIEM or EEM?

Year-to-date, the DIEM ETF saw +$31M in flows, compared to +$3.49B for EEM.

Which ETF is more volatile: DIEM or EEM?

Over the past year, DIEM had a volatility of 19.22%, while EEM experienced 22.15%.

Which ETF is bigger: DIEM or EEM?

As of July 17, 2026, DIEM holds $68.78 M in assets under management (AUM), while EEM manages $28.08 B.

What sectors do the DIEM and EEM ETFs invest in?

DIEM leans toward sectors like Technology and Finance. Meanwhile, EEM focuses on Technology and Finance.

What are the top holdings of the DIEM ETF and EEM ETF?

DIEM top holdings include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Co., Ltd.,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d. and SK hynix, Inc.. EEM holds in its top three: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Co., Ltd.,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d. and SK hynix, Inc..

Which ETF is more diversified: DIEM or EEM?

DIEM holds 527 securities with 43.42% of its assets in the top 15. EEM has 1187 securities and a top 15 weight of 42.54%.
